Obesity Rates Remain High in Alabama



That middle-age girth among baby boomers appears to be following them into retirement. The nation's annual obesity rankings show Mississippi is still the most portly state among baby boomers, with some 32.5 percent of its baby boomer residents classified as obese. Alabama ranked second with 31.2 percent of the state's adult population in the obese range. West Virginia, Tennessee and South Carolina round out the states with the heaviest retirees. The report from two health-related agencies shows the really bad news is that obesity rates among adults rose in 23 states over the past year -- and declined nowhere.
